Most times when we see an artwork at a museum, we look to its label to know more about it. Artwork labels are a critical part of museum exhibits — they can frame perceptions, offer perspectives, challenge assumptions, and provide explanations. Museum professionals dedicate a large amount of time discussing labels and studying what effects they have on visitor behaviour.
Led by MAP’s Jayati Srivastava, this session will begin with a guided walk of the ongoing exhibition, Outside-In: Meera Mukherjee and Jaidev Baghel. This will be followed by an activity where participants will be split into groups, and they choose an object at the exhibition to collaboratively come up with an alternate label for. The final part of the workshop will focus on group discussions on the labels created, insights gleaned, and explore questions like, “What story will a visitor leave with after they read a museum label?”
